What would you say would be the best simulator for electrical engineering students. I am currently using MultiSim. [Note: the simulator must be able to acutally run schematics and not only able to construct the circuit].
For electronic circuit simulation MultiSim is good. PSpice is another standard and is also good if you can afford it. LTSpice is probably the best free circuit simulator available.
Here's another free one: Qucs project: Quite Universal Circuit Simulator
It's a work in progress, but it seems to be quite powerful, and it runs on several different platforms.
The biggest problem at the moment is lack of good documentation.
